Communications Enabled Applications (CEA) 範例

您可以使用 WebSphere® Application Server V8.5 ,將動態 Web 通訊新增至應用程式或商業程序。 提供兩個主要服務:電話系統存取和多重模式 Web 互動。 您可以使用這套範例應用程式來探索服務,當作您自行開發 Communications Enabled Applications 時的出發點。

設定及配置這些範例所需的時間

一至二小時

使用前必備項目

  • WebSphere Application Server 8.0 版或 8.5 版
  • Rational® Application Developer 8.0 版或 8.5 版 (選用)
重要事項: 這些範例已在 WebSphere Application Server 8.0 版及 8.5 版中經過測試。

範例下載

如果要使用範例,請從產品下載網站下載 CEA 範例檔。 請完成下列步驟:

  1. 選擇下列其中一種方法,將 CEASamples.zip 檔案下載至工作站上的目錄: HTTPS 或 FTP (ftp://public.dhe.ibm.com/software/websphere/appserv/library/v80/samples/CEASamples.zip)。 您可以在工作站上建立 /samples/cea 目錄路徑,並將 CEA 範例檔下載至該目錄路徑。
  2. 從顯示的對話框中,指定用來儲存壓縮檔的目標目錄,然後按一下確定
  3. CEASamples.zip 檔案包含的範例檔位於下列目錄結構中:
    
    /images
    /installableApps
    /PlantsByWebsphere
    /scripts
    /WebServices
    /style
    readme.html
    注意: readme.html 檔案包含安裝及執行範例的相關資訊。

範例說明

PlantsByWebSphere Ajax Edition for CEA

PlantsByWebSphere Ajax Edition for CEA 應用程式是一種線上工廠苗圃,可展示 Java™ EE 應用程式的一般性質,其中包含模型 (EJB 元件)、視圖 (JSP 檔) 及控制器 (Servlet) 設計型樣。 這是使用 AJAX 和 Java EE 技術進行實驗的簡單方法。 這個 PlantsByWebSphere Ajax Edition 版本已加強,以展示 WebSphere Application Server的電腦電話系統整合及 Web 協同作業功能。

如需完整的設定和使用指示,請參閱 CEA 範例套件的 PlantsByWebSphere/docs 目錄中的 index.html 檔案。 WebSphere Application Server V8.5 說明文件中的 設定及使用已啟用通訊的應用程式範例 主題中也提供其他資訊 (包括示範實務範例)。

Web 服務範例應用程式

CEA Web 服務範例應用程式提供介面來控制電話。 它實作為基本 Servlet,會呼叫 CEA Web 服務 API。

此範例用到 CEA 的電話系統特性;因此,必須配置並啟動 IP-PBX。 此外,您必須透過管理主控台或 wsadmin Scripting 來配置 CEA 使用 IP-PBX。 另外,此範例使用的任何電話必須以 IP-PBX 啟動並登錄。 至少必須向 IP-PBX 登錄兩支電話。 監視第一支電話,撥打第二支電話。

如需基本設定指示,請參閱 CEA 範例套件的根目錄中的 readme.html 檔案。 詳細資訊 (包括示範實務範例) 可在 WebSphere Application Server V8.5 說明文件的 設定及使用已啟用通訊的應用程式範例 主題中找到。

IP-PBX 範例應用程式

IP-PBX 範例應用程式適用於示範和簡易測試。 範例 IP-PBX 是一種可安裝在應用程式伺服器上的企業應用程式。 應用程式 commsvc.pbx.ear 位於 CEA 範例套件的 /installableApps 目錄中。

如需基本設定指示,請參閱 CEA 範例套件的根目錄中的 readme.html 檔案。 詳細資訊 (包括示範實務範例) 可在 WebSphere Application Server V8.5 說明文件的 設定及使用已啟用通訊的應用程式範例 主題中找到。